[FS - VIC] or Trade, Type 3 Wagon


Hi Everyone,

I am taking delivery of the Type 3 Wagon pictured below on Saturday and can now take expressions of interest. I bought the vehicle for the chassis to put under my Condor so I would have discs and irs. The wagon is in pretty good condition and has been shedded for much of its life although it is outside at the moment. All the glass and interior looks good. I'm told it is a runner but has a knock in one cylinder. I have a number of options:

Option 1: I lift this body onto my older type 3 chassis and sell outright.

Option 2: I trade this complete car for a really good later chassis with irs and discs. I am happy to negotiate for the right deal.

Option 3: I use the later chassis and part out the complete car.

Any option will require the pick up of the vehicle from Horsham, Victoria (approximately 3.5 hours west of Melbourne).
